Tweet Your Eats: Gnocchi to Gazpacho

Each week, we ask you to tweet us the best (and the not so great) dishes from your eating adventures.

Each week, we ask you to tweet us the best dishes from your eating adventures from over the weekend. And you always deliver with a Twitter stream full of enticing choices. Check out the list below to see what Twitterers around town want a second helping of; if you want to see a favorite dish included, tweet @bestbitesblog, and we'll update the list to include your recommendation.

(Psst—you can also follow Washingtonian on Twitter here, and food and dining editor Todd Kliman here.)

kimchiquita: Restaurant week at SEI #tweeteat short ribs were phenomenal — columbia heights day, zip car membership!
 
iwritegourmet: Magnolia's Purcellville wknd comfort food at its best. Grilled Salmon salad w/ goat chse & golden Allagash Tripel.
 
ATBinDC: @bestbitesblog Brunch at Busboys & Poets. Buckwheat pancakes, eggs & fruit for $7.95. Delicious. Waitress was a bit surly though.
 
nikkirap: @bestbitesblog gnocchi with summer veggies from Proof was rich, creamy and simply amazing & paired w/ a delicious french red wine
 
discojing: One of the most delicious meals in my life at VOLT. 4 courses-$45. Chowder, ravioli, sturgeoun, choco
 
CarpeDC: Hook. Beautifully done bluefish over polenta, cool, zingy gazpacho, and sweet and sour buttermilk panna cotta+great service.
 
bistrobess: had a great RW dinner at Dino. Loved loved loved the lasagnette and the Nutella "Cappucino"
 
shoescocktails: Eggplant gazpacho w/ tomato pearls and basil oil at Kora was super flavorful & delicious
